Magnolia grandiflora 'Little Gem'
Notes

Uses: Evergreen magnolia has rich glossy leaves and large creamy white fragrant flowers in summer.
'Little Gem' is smaller and more compact than M.grandiflora. The flowers are a little smaller but more prolific. Needs to be protected from hot northerly winds. Useful as a screening plant
Roots need to be kept moist during dry periods and do not like being disturbed once planted out of the pot.
Frost tolerant once established.

  • Canopy Shape canopy-oval Oval
  • Height 4-8m
  • Spread 2-5m
  • Position
    • position-fullsun Full Sun
  • Family Magnoliaceae
  • Botanical Name Magnolia grandiflora 'Little Gem'
  • Habit Dense
  • Landscape Plains, Footslopes, Hills
  • Soil Texture Clay, Loam, Sand
  • pH Acidic, Alkaline, Neutral
  • Tolerates Light frost
  • Supplementary Watering Minimal
  • Flower Colour White
  • Flowering Time Summer
  • Foliage Dark-green
  • Flower Type Clusters
  • Purpose Ornamental
  • Evergreen/Deciduous Evergreen
  • Trunk Smooth
  • Form Medium Tree (Usually between 5m & 11m)
